首页
Python
Java
前端
数据库
Linux
Chatgpt专题
开发者工具箱
dynamodb专题
DynamoDB 小结
DynamoDB 简介 DynamoDB 是AWS 提供一个 NoSql 数据库服务。它是一个Region级别的服务,针对用户对读写性能的要求进行不同的收费。 注意 dynamodb 库中对一些数据类型支持不友好,dynamodb2 中对这些问题进行了完善。 遇到的问题 表项并发更新问题 dyanmo 数据表中数据进行 partial_save 时,产生ConditionChec
阅读更多...
aws DynamoDB 使用步骤(一)
第1步:创建一个表 在这一步,你在Amazon DynamoDB中创建一个音乐表。该表有以下细节。 分区键 - Artist 排序键 - SongTitle 使用AWS管理控制台 要使用DynamoDB控制台创建一个新的音乐表。 1.登录到AWS管理控制台,在https://console.aws.amazon.com/dynamodb/,打开DynamoDB控制台。 2.在控制台左侧
阅读更多...
通过写代码学习AWS DynamoDB (3)- 一致性hash
简介 在本文中,我们将简单介绍一致性hash(consistent hash)的概念,以及一致性hash可以解决的问题。然后我们将在模拟的DDB实现中实现一个简单版本的基于一致性harsh实现的partition。 问题 在《通过写代码学习AWS DynamoDB (2)》中我们的DDB使用了最朴素的hash算法来分配一个key/value存储的partition。也就是使用 key %
阅读更多...
AWS 专题学习 P8 (ECS、EKS、Lambda、CloudFront、DynamoDB)
文章目录 什么是 Docker?操作系统上的 DockerDocker 镜像存储Docker vs. Virtual MachinesDocker 入门AWS 中的 Docker Containers Management Amazon ECSEC2 Launch TypeFargate Launch TypeECS 的 IAM RolesLoad Balancer Integrations
阅读更多...
DynamoDB初体验
前言 DynamoDB作为AWS云服务一部分,也支持本地化应用,本章将介绍如何在本地构建基础运行环境。 本章概要 安装DynamoDB Local;AWS CLI安装;AWS CLI使用 安装DynamoDB Local 通过官方下载安装文件,下载完成后直接解压即可; 启动服务 通过如下命令即可启动:java -Djava.library.path=./DynamoDBLocal_
阅读更多...
DynamoDB和Cassandra、MongoDB的比较
DynamoDB和Cassandra、MongoDB的比较 前面说过Cassandra受2007年Amazon发表的Dynamo论文影响非常深,在DynamoDB发布的第一天,提供Cassandra商业化支持的DataStax公司的Jonathan Ellis就写了一篇文章,分析了Cassandra和DynamoDB的差异。 虽然Jonathan Ellis认为DynamoDB不支持Secon
阅读更多...
宣布推出适用于 Amazon DynamoDB 的增量导出到 S3
今天,Amazon DynamoDB 宣布全面推出增量导出到 S3,该功能用于仅导出在指定时间间隔内发生更改的数据。通过增量导出,您现在能够以较小的增量导出已插入、更新或删除的数据。您只需在亚马逊云科技管理控制台中单击几下、通过简单的 API 调用或亚马逊云科技命令行界面,即可导出从几 MB 到数 TB 规模不等的更改后数据。选择启用了时间点恢复的 DynamoDB 表,指定您想要增量数据的导出时
阅读更多...
DynamoDB 写入读取容量
最近使用DynamoDB才发现里面一堆坑。踩进去全是钱。 DynamoDB 是依据读取容量 写入容量和数据存储大小(表和索引)收费。这个读取容量写入容量就很恐怖了。还有autoScaling自动扩容也全是钱 所以这里非常有必要了解下读取容量和写入容量。天天读AWS的文档人都不好了。 官方文档:https://docs.aws.amazon.com/zh_cn/amazondynamodb/l
阅读更多...